Output 5907ba48e186e5f6e27b3953fba4b1047f86e9423bfb9f17891d772fbf83f217:12

value
423694
script pubkey
OP_HASH160 OP_PUSHBYTES_20 331f82e651b381d6941b557e681f6674f7fa54e9 OP_EQUAL
address
36ML8mkt1BAhAkBDtUeWHXvRZas2QDyxaA
transaction
5907ba48e186e5f6e27b3953fba4b1047f86e9423bfb9f17891d772fbf83f217
confirmations
310923
spent
true